Can you believe an officer who fatally shot a pregnant Black mother and her unborn child has been cleared of any wrongdoing by a police review board? This astonishing decision follows the tragic August 24, 2023, incident in a Kroger parking lot in Ohio, where Officer Connor Grubb shot 21-year-old Ta’Kiya Young. Young, accused of shoplifting, was approached by officers who demanded she exit her car; bodycam footage even captures her asking, “Are you going to shoot me?” Moments later, as her car slowly rolled forward towards Grubb, he fired a single bullet through her windshield, killing her and her unborn daughter. Grubb claimed he felt the vehicle hit his legs and lift his body, prompting him to shoot in self-defense. However, Young's family attorney, Sean Walton, vehemently stated that the department's policies are a "clear and present danger," accusing Grubb of choosing escalation over de-escalation. Despite a Franklin County jury having already acquitted Grubb of murder and other charges, this internal review board’s finding has sparked further outrage and questions about accountability. The deaths of Ta’Kiya Young and her unborn daughter remain a profound tragedy, leaving many to wonder about the future of police interactions.
